    People on here typically call it "banking" calories. I aim not for a set amount of calories per day, but instead a set amount of calories per week. Every day, I shave off 40 cal here, 120 cal there, so that when Saturday hits I can drink those 5 diet coke and vodkas. Works perfectly well for me.
